High Winds Force Clean-Up Crews Out of High Cascades Area

Due to the hazard to public and crew safety, the Oregon 62 closure is back to Prospect from Union Creek. These winds have halted progress for the day due to hazard trees.

Crews will re-evaluate in the morning. But with another foot of snow in the forecast tonight and tomorrow, clean-up work will be evaluated day by day.

Current High Cascade closures as of 1/15/20 at 5PM:

  • Highway 138 closed from Toketee to U.S. 97
  • Oregon 62/230 closed at Prospect
